Reformatted excerpts from Nicolas Pouillard's message of 2011-02-22:
> I would love to see a simple Unix/command/CLI defined for the server. To
> make myself clear, a bit like the notmuch CLI. This would allow for a
> greater modularity and reusablity between components.

I am definitely interested in a set of composable CLI tools that talk to the
server, for basic operations like search, show, add/remove labels, etc.

> For instance I would like to index my mails with differents backends (disk
> is cheap), to get a way to compare different tools on real data, when
> searching emails, and thus allow to debug the different tools.

The server implementation is pretty heavily tied to a particular index and
store mechanism. It's not clear to me how (or whether) the CLI tools will
allow you to swap out different implementations.
